Lillian A. Ball

January 20, 1931 - February 3, 2017

Service Date: February 7, 2017

Funeral Home Harding Litwin Funeral Home

Funeral Service will be Tuesday at 11am from Harding-Litwin Funeral Home, 123 West Tioga Street, Tunkhannock, PA 18657, with Rev. Jon Buxton of the Tunkhannock United Methodist Church officiating. Interment is at Sunnyside Cemetery. Family and Friends may call at the funeral home on Monday evening 5 – 8pm and also on Tuesday an hour before the time of service.
